### 1. Keyword Map Completeness
|
|
|
|
- [ ] Primary keywords defined (at least 3)
|
|
- [ ] Each keyword has search intent classification (informational/navigational/transactional)
|
|
- [ ] Keywords are relevant to business goals in Product Brief
|
|
- [ ] Long-tail variants included where appropriate
|
|
|
|
### 2. Page Assignments
|
|
|
|
- [ ] Each primary keyword mapped to at least one intended page
|
|
- [ ] No two pages target the exact same primary keyword
|
|
- [ ] Page assignments are realistic given project scope
|
|
|
|
### 3. Cross-Phase Readiness
|
|
|
|
- [ ] Keyword map is in a format Phase 3 (Scenarios) can reference
|
|
- [ ] SEO priorities align with user priorities from Trigger Map
|
|
- [ ] Content structure supports keyword targeting
